Overview:

Hisense USA is seeking a Commercial Cooling Business Development Manager to help establish and grow our commercial cooling business in US. This role will focus on developing relationships with beverage companies, bottlers, foodservice operators, distributors, and retail customers, while identifying new business opportunities for commercial refrigeration and cooling solutions.

 

Key Responsibilities:

Business Development

  • Identify and pursue new business opportunities within the commercial cooling and beverage industries.
  • Support the development of relationships with key potential customers, including Coca-Cola, PepsiCo, Beverage bottlers, Convenience store chains, Foodservice customers and Distribution partners.
  • Assist in customer presentations, business reviews, and proposal development.

Key Account Support

  • Support strategic account management activities for commercial cooling customers.
  • Work closely with customers to understand equipment and operational needs.
  • Help develop long-term growth opportunities within assigned accounts.

Product & Market Development

  • Monitor industry trends, customer needs, and competitive activities.
  • Provide market feedback to product management and engineering teams.
  • Support product launches and commercialization initiatives.

Cross-Functional Collaboration

  • Partner with Sales, Product Management, Engineering, Supply Chain, and Service teams to deliver customer solutions.
  • Coordinate customer projects from initial opportunity through implementation.
  • Ensure timely communication and execution of customer requirements.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in business, Engineering, Marketing, Supply Chain, or related field.
  • 5+ years of experience in one or more of the following: Commercial refrigeration, Beverage equipment, Foodservice equipment, Retail refrigeration, or Cold chain solutions
  • Strong communication, negotiation, and presentation skills.
  • Prior experience supporting or managing business relationships with Coca-Cola, PepsiCo, bottlers, foodservice operators, or commercial refrigeration manufacturers.
  • Strong industry connections and a proven ability to build partnerships within the beverage, refrigeration, and cold-chain sectors.

What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
